General Summary: The positions's primary responsibility is to greet customers that visit or call the ReStore, answer questions and provide information about the ReStore and about the Habitat affiliate, scheduling donor pickups and communicating pickup schedule with drivers. Position is also responsible for assisting other volunteers and staff as needed.

Primary Responsibilities

  • Greet customers by phone or in person and answer questions pertaining to general information

 

  • Explain the layout of the ReStore and the range of inventory on hand

 

  • Escort customers to specific items when appropriate and explain the purchase options

 

  • Operate the cash register and serve as the cashier for sales transactions

 

  • Handle cash, debit, and credit card transactions

 

  • Adhere to and enforce shopper, donor and volunteer policies for held or purchased items

 

  • Explain to shoppers, donors, and volunteers ReStore regulations when needed with excellent customer service

 

Qualifications

  • Display excellent customer service skills to donors, shoppers and volunteers both in person and on the telephone

 

  • Must be people-oriented, flexible, enthusiastic, and willing to advocate the mission of Crystal Coast Habitat for Humanity

 

  • Must possess the ability to plan, organize and handle multiple functions simultaneously & communicate clearly and courteously, both verbally and in Good comunication skills

 

  • Friendly and helpful attitude

 

  • Previous cash handling experience preferred

 

  • Good math skills - ability to use a calculator

 

  • Ability to do light lifting

 

  • Ability to stay on feet for extended period of time

 

  • Reference from another business or organization is a must
